Recent Updates: The Road to the Semifinal
The journey to this semifinal has been paved with impressive performances from both sides. Tigres overcame reigning MLS champions LA Galaxy in the quarterfinals, showcasing their strength against international competition. Meanwhile, Cruz Azul triumphed over their bitter rivals, Club América, in a highly anticipated clásico, proving their mettle in high-pressure situations. These victories have earned both teams their place among the final four of the competition.

The Significance of the Concacaf Champions Cup
The Concacaf Champions Cup is the premier club competition in North America, Central America, and the Caribbean. Winning this tournament not only brings regional prestige but also secures a coveted spot in the FIFA Club World Cup, where the champion can compete against the best teams from around the globe.
Managerial Debutants: Vicente Sánchez vs. Guido Pizarro
An interesting subplot to this semifinal is the presence of two relatively new managers. Cruz Azul is led by Vicente Sánchez, while Tigres is guided by Guido Pizarro. Both coaches are making their mark in their respective debuts, adding an element of unpredictability to the tactical approaches we might see. Pizarro has publicly praised Sánchez's work, acknowledging the impressive progress Cruz Azul has made under his leadership.
